Dependent variable
y = Quality of Well Being score (QWB) at two years
Independent variables
x1: Intervention
x1 = 1 if person was in intervention group
= 0 otherwise
x2:QWB at baseline
x2 = baseline score
x3:Gender
x3 = 1 if person was a male
= 0 otherwise, ie a female
33 - 5
x4-5: Age
x4 = 1 if age 75-84
= 0 otherwise
x5 = 1 if age 85 +
= 0 otherwise
x6-7: CHQ
x6 = 1 if moderate
= 0 otherwise
x7 = 1 if severe
= 0 otherwise
x8: Physically active
x8 = 1 if 3 times per week
= 0 if < three times per week
33 - 6
x9: Reduced weight
x9 = 1 if tried to lose weight
= 0 otherwise
x10:Medigap (Other insurance)
x10 = 1 if Medigap insurance
= 0 if otherwise, ie Medicaid
x11:Education
x11 = education level in years
x12:Education x Intervention interaction
x12 = (x11)*(x1)
